Frequently Asked Questions

What are the main challenges when shooting the K1A1 at 500 yards?

Shooting the K1A1 at 500 yards is challenging due to its rudimentary iron sights, where the front sight post can obscure the target. The 1:12 twist barrel also limits stability at longer ranges, requiring advanced aiming techniques like 'Kentucky Windage'.

How does the K1A1's recoil compare to an AR-15?

The K1A1 exhibits a 'stouter' recoil impulse compared to a tuned AR-15. This is partly due to its gas system being designed for a shorter barrel, leading to increased dwell time with the 16-inch export version, and a wobbly wire stock.

What is the historical significance of the K1A1 rifle?

The K1A1 is historically significant as the 'Rooftop Korean's Choice' during the 1992 LA Riots. It became an iconic symbol of self-reliance and community defense for business owners protecting their property.

What are the key technical specifications of the K1A1 export version?

The export K1A1 features a 16-inch barrel with a 1:12 twist rate, weighs approximately 6.8 lbs, and has an overall length of 29.8 inches. It uses standard STANAG magazines and fires 5.56x45mm NATO or .223 Remington ammunition.
